Genetics Timeline

  • Gregor Mendel

    Gregor Mendel
    Gregor Mendel bred pea plants to find the ways parents pass traits to their offspring. He cross fertilized several generations of peas plants and discovered how traits are recessive of dominant, He founded the basic principles of genetics.
  • Willam Bateson and Reginald Punnett

    Willam Bateson and Reginald Punnett
    William Bateson and Reginald Punnett were performed a dyhybrid cross on pea plants. The results produced were different from the results they expected acorrding to Mendel's principles of genetics. They didn't know it then but they had discovered linked genes, which follow different patterns.
  • Thomas Hunt Morgan

    Thomas Hunt Morgan
    Theomas Hunt Morgan crossed two fruit flies, a wild type fruit fly and and a fruit fly with a black body and vestigal wings. His results included recombinant phenotypes along with the expected parental phenotypes. He discovered crossing over.

    George Beadle and Edward Tatumm were working with breadmold. They were experimenting with strains that couldn't grow and found that each strain lacked an essential enzyme in the metabolic pathway.The came up with the one gene- one enzyme hypothesis. It says that one gene is linked to and controls the production of one enzyme.
  • Erwin Chargaff

    Erwin Chargaff
    Erwin Chargaff looked at the amounts of adenine, thymine, guanie, and cytosine in different species. He found that the amount of adenine is always equal to the amount of thymine, and that the amount of guanine is always equal to the amount of cytosine.

  • Marshall Nirenberg

    Marshall Nirenberg
    Marshall Nierenberg was working on deciphering the genetic "code". He made an RNA molecule by connecting identical RNA nucleotides with uracil bases. There was only one condon UUU. He discovered that UUU is specific to phenylaline. From his reasearch the condons of all amino acids were found
